Attitude of students towards rural horticultural work experience programme in Karnataka

Abstract:
Rural Horticultural Work Experience Programme provides an opportunity for the students to try on experimental basis when they are on the verge of completing their degree programme. The main objective of this course is to apply the Principles of Extension Education which they have studied in the class room during their four years of degree in real life experience or field situation. In this context it is necessary to study the effects in terms of attitude towards knowledge gained and skills acquired by the students. The study mainly deals with the attitude of students towards village stay, night meetings, group discussion and their field exposure and experience. The results of the study reveals that 58.05 percent of the respondents strongly agreed and have favorable attitude towards night meetings/group discussion meetings, 59.16 percent of the respondents revealed village stay and attachment to Raitha Smparka Kendra during RHWE programme was favorable. It was also noticed that 63.27% of the respondents expressed positive attitude towards skill development during RHWE in terms of communication skill, leadership quality.
